Medical bills can be burdensome to many Indian families, particularly in case of medical emergencies. That is where the Ayushman Bharat Pradhan Mantri Jan Arogya Yojana (PM-JAY) comes to your rescue.
It is an exceptional government program that provides cashless hospitalization benefits up to ₹5 lakhs on a family floater basis annually, allowing beneficiaries to receive primary, secondary, and tertiary healthcare services. Getting the Ayushman card is a simple process that allows you to enjoy the benefits of health coverage. However, there are certain eligibility requirements that you must fulfil to avail of this card:
● Families with no adult members between 16 and 59 years.
● Female-headed households with no adult male members between 16 and 59 years.
● Households with a single room that have kucha walls and roofs.
● Scheduled castes and scheduled tribes’ households.
● Families with disabled members do not have any breadwinners.
● Landless families work as manual casual labour as their major means of livelihood.
● Primitive and especially vulnerable tribal groups
● Families who practice manual scavenging
● Alms-dependent destitute families
● Families practising bonded labour
Additionally, this scheme covers all senior citizens aged 70 and older, irrespective of their income status.
Below is a list of documents you might need for the online application for the Ayushman card:
● Aadhaar card for identification and biometric authentication
● Income certificate
● Caste certificate
● Family members' documents like CM letter, PM letter, or Ration card
● Bank account papers
The Ayushman card is a gateway to cashless medical treatment and hospitalization services under the PMJAY scheme. You can get the Ayushman card either online or offline through the steps described below:
Follow these steps to apply for an Ayushman Bharat card online:
Step 1: Open the Pradhan Mantri Jan Arogya Yojana website and go to the 'Am I Eligible' link under the menu.
Step 2: You will be taken to the Beneficiary NHA portal. Choose the 'Beneficiary' option and sign in using your mobile number, captcha code, and the OTP you received on your mobile.
Step 3: Select 'PMJAY' as the scheme and enter the necessary details, such as your state and district.
Step 4: In the ‘Search by’ section, select 'Aadhaar Number' and enter your Aadhaar number.
Step 5: The list of all family members and their Ayushman card status will be displayed.
Step 6: If your Ayushman Bharat card status is ‘Not-Generated,’ click on ‘Apply Now’ in the ‘Action’ column.
Step 7: Confirm your identity through your UID number by providing the OTP received on your registered mobile number.
Step 8: Provide the necessary information about family members, such as their mobile numbers, and complete the submission of the details to complete the online application for the Ayushman card.
After your application is sanctioned, you can download your Ayushman Bharat card.
To apply for an Ayushman Bharat card offline, go to a local empanelled hospital or an Ayushman Mitra. Remember to carry your identification documents, such as your Aadhaar card and other required documents, to complete the registration. The staff will assist you in further procedures to receive your Ayushman Bharat card.
Mentioned below are the common benefits that you can claim from the Ayushman card:
● Cashless Treatment Up to ₹5 Lakh Per Year
The eligible families can avail the facility of cashless hospitalization coverage ranging from ₹30,000 to ₹5,00,000 per year. This coverage is offered at network public and private hospitals across India for a range of secondary and tertiary health problems.
● 24 Medical Specialties Access
Ayushman Card covers treatment in 24 specialities of medicine, including key areas like oncology (cancer), cardiology (heart), neurosurgery (brain), and orthopaedics (joints and bones).
● Pre- and Post-Hospitalization Expenses Coverage
The eligible families can also get reimbursement for medical care expenditures incurred within 15 days prior to and subsequent to a hospitalization. This covers the costs of diagnostics, follow-up visits, and medications.
● Comprehensive Coverage of Medical Procedures
The Ayushman card covers 1,929 surgical procedures and provides end-to-end financial protection for all types of treatments. It covers expenses for surgery, diagnosis, drugs, rooms, ICU, operation theatre, surgeon charges, and medical equipment.
